Australia Awards - Endeavour Executive Awards
Build international professional links and collaborations with Australia.
The Endeavour Executive Award provides up to AUS$18,500 for international applicants in business, industry, education or government to undertake 1-4 months of professional development in Australia.

The Award enables the recipient to build skills and knowledge in a host work environment through activities such as: management training, peer-to-peer learning, mentoring, and short courses. Applicants must be nominated by an Australian host organisation and the professional development activity must be vocationally useful and not geared toward completion of a degree, or an immediate commercial outcome.
The Endeavour Executive Awards are funded by the Australian government and aim to deepen professional engagements, while building linkages and networks between Australia and participating countries.
The Endeavour Awards is the Australian Government’s internationally competitive, merit-based scholarship program providing opportunities for citizens of the Asia-Pacific, the Middle East, Europe and the Americas to undertake study, research and professional development in Australia. Awards are also available for Australians to undertake study, research and professional development abroad.
The Endeavour Awards aim to:
· Develop on-going educational, research and professional linkages between individuals, organisations and countries;
· Provide opportunities for high achieving individuals from Australia and overseas to increase their skills and enhance their global awareness;
· Contribute to Australia’s position as a high quality education and training provider, and a leader in research and innovation; and
· Increase the productivity of Australians through an international study, research or professional development experience.
The Endeavour Awards are a part of the Australia Awards initiative which was announced by the Government in November 2009. The Australia Awards have been established to maximise the benefit to Australia of its extensive scholarship programs, and to support enduring ties between Australia and our neighbours.
The Australia Awards will bring together the international development awards administrated by the Australian Agency for International Development (AusAID) and the Department of Education, Employment and Workplace Relations’ (DEEWR) Endeavour Awards under a single recognisable brand.
